The Installation and Operation Status of Environmental Sample Analysis System at KOMAC

Korea multi-purpose accelerator complex (KOMAC), which belongs to the Korea Atomic Energy Research Institute (KAERI), has started the performance test operation in the second half of 2013 and currently operates one 20MeV beamline and three 100MeV beamlines. KOMAC's environmental samples analysis system measures the radioactivity of several water samples in the KOMAC site after the test operation period has passed. As a result of measurement with the rainwater and drinking water samples collected from the general area of the KOMAC site, it was confirmed that the measured value is much lower than the effluents control limit. The future operation plan of the environmental sample analysis system is to measure and analyze the environmental radioactivity of the soil or the plant by expending the range of the measurement target sample and analysis. Therefore, sample pretreatment equipment is prepared for this process and for gamma nuclide analysis, searching for the HPGe detector type to satisfy the experimental conditions. KOMAC's environmental sample analysis system operation goal is to build a more systematic sample analysis process and utilize the results of environmental sample analysis as experimental research data and to improve the efficiency of radiation safety management work by monitoring the radiation around the center environment.
